Hiv positive people might be doing masturbation in toilets. They touch the tap of water tube.?


They touch the tap of water tube with fingers wet with semen. A slight amount of semen may remain unwashed as the person thinks that it is not necessary to wash it because the next person who is going to use the tapcan not notice it despite being sensitive to its presence on the tap. The next person may have a slight breaching in mouth or bleeding gums.
Does this situation carry any possibility of Hiv infection?
Why?

You are safe!!!
The virus that causes aids cannot live for very long outside the body and then you really do need to have an open wound on your finger at just the right spot immediately after the person left the sink to even consider the outside possibility of contracting it.
How ever if you are still concerned about the risk all you need to do is use a paper towel to turn the water on and off.

The chances of infection are so close to 0 they may as well be 0. Any HIV virus in the semen will be dead on exposure to air within seconds.
